Abstract

In this paper, we propose a new method for electromagnetic interference (EMI) noise analysis using an analog radio-over-fiber (RoF) link, cross domain analyzer, and mobile robot. With this new method, both the phase distribution and amplitude distribution of an electric field radiated by an EMI noise source can be measured. From the measured and simulated results obtained using the method of moments technique, we show that we can differentiate between noise sources in different positions using the phase distribution measured on a measurement circle.
